Effluent Treatment Plant

Orden Platz (India) Pvt. Ltd., is a year old manufacturing company that brings forth Effluent Treatment Plant. ETP must be installed in every industry in which waste water is generated during the process. This plant can be employed to treat the waste water, either for re-use or safe release in the environment. This plant is capable of treating toxic material and pollutants in the industrial effluents. The effluent passes through several stages in the treatment process. Several processes that are followed for the efficient effluent treatment are chemical, biological, physical and membrane. Industries, like dairy, chemicals, petrochemical, pharmaceutical, paint and textile, can use effluent treatment plant to save the environment against pollution.

The organic matter while degrading naturally under anaerobic condition generates bio gas.
Controlled biogas production of is an essential part of global carbon cycle.
Around eight hundred million tones of methane is released into the atmosphere every year. Bio gas comprises 30% of carbon dioxide and 70% of methane.
6KW/M3 is the Calorific Value of methane.

Three steps of producing Bio gas:

Hydrolysis:
It is where enzymes degrades complex carbohydrate, lipid and proteins into their constituents units
Acedogenesis: It is where  hydrolysis products are converted to hydrogen, CO2 and acetic SCID.
Methanogenesis: It is where obligate anaerobic bacteria controls production of methane form acedogenesis products.
